How Bentley’s Petrol Legacy Actually Drives Innovation Today
Several converging trends explain why Bentley’s petrol past is back in the spotlight. First, a cultural nostalgia boom is driving renewed interest in classic performance and craftsmanship. American buyers—particularly younger, tech-savvy consumers—are seeking vehicles that blend heritage with authenticity, and petrol-engine power remains a symbol of raw, visceral driving joy.
Bentley’s return to petrol isn’t a step back—it’s a reinvention. Modern iterations integrate advanced turbocharging, hybrid efficiency, and lightweight materials to deliver performance once dependent on raw fuel power. Today’s engines prioritize responsiveness, refinement, and sustainability without sacrificing the soul of a true luxury drive.
